Overview

This award-winning U.K. electro-acoustic composer originally released this recording in the late '70s and was groundbreaking in his pursuit of the genre and one of the few English academic composers working with electronics at the time. This Paradigm CD is a reissue of the famed 1979 LP with four additional pieces never before released. Beach Regularity is an excerpt from a day-long happening in which the composer performed with an ensemble that featured saxophonist Lynn Dobson, avant-tuba player Melvyn Poore, vocalist Poppy Holden, and clarinet improviser Robin Coombes. This performance was designed somewhat like a social intervention, where the musicians performed in conjunction with tape-music and electronics broadcast from small portable stereo systems scattered along the English seaside. Four short sections make up Menagerie in a display of some of the most sophisticated electro-acoustic music of the time, and the final piece added to this CD is a solo vocal work entitled "Vocalise," which is a spontaneous-sounding improvisation. This collection combines the influence of free-improvisation, electronics, and modern composition techniques into a unified and highly developed avant-garde music. An important composer working on the fringes of numerous genres, Trevor Wishart extraordinary skill is exhibited well on this CD reissue, as most of his recordings are extremely obscure self-released LPs. ~ Skip Jansen, All Music Guide
